SOUTH POINT — The Chesapeake Lady Panthers were certainly not offended by their offense.

The Lady Panthers had three players in double figures as they routed the Greenup County (Ky.) Lady Musketeers 67-45 on Saturday in the South Point Holiday Tournament.

“Offensively, we played well. We passed the ball well and shared it well,” said Chesapeake coach Chris Ball.

“Defensively, we wanted to take away the (Micah) Leslie girl. She had 30 points twice this year. Natalie Hall, Brooke Webb and Baylee Mills did a nice job on Leslie, but we didn’t play good team defense. Greenup is solid so it’s a good win for us.”

Sydnee Hall had 15 points, 10 assists, 7 rebounds and 3 steals to lead the Lady Panthers (4-2). Atiya Spaulding scored 17 points and Kaylee Curry had 14 points and 5 rebounds.

Kelsey Curry added 6 rebounds and Natalie Hall 6 assists for Chesapeake.

Greenup County (4-4) got 14 points from Leslie and 12 from Jordan Moore.

“Sydnee Hall had a nice all-around game. When we broke the pressure, she was able to hit the open man,” said Balls.

Sydnee Hall scored 9 points and Kaylee Curry 8 in the first quarter as Chesapeake raced to a 24-12 lead.

Spaulding had 6 points in the second quarter and the lead was 39-21 at the break.

Leslie got 6 points in the third quarter, but Chesapeake still extended its lead to 55-34 and was never threatened.

Chesapeake hosts its Holiday Tournament on Monday. South Point faces Greenup County at 6 p.m. and Chesapeake meets Lincoln County at 7:30.

On Tuesday, the losers play at noon followed by the championship game at 2 p.m.
